Jay Sera will release her new single ‘I Loved You’ on March 1st at 6PM through various online music sites.
The new song ‘I Loved You’ depicts the different emotions of a couple who have passed the days of passionate love and are facing a breakup. The calm melody and heartbreaking lyrics expressing the sadness of a woman who cannot accept a breakup create empathy.
The song begins softly, as if humming, “I loved, I loved,” and the lyrical lyrics, such as “I won‘t forget you, whom I loved so much, the dazzlingly beautiful images of you and me/If only I could go back, I wouldn’t leave, I‘m nothing without you/Today, too, I’m in pain, I miss you,” create a sorrowful mood.
Jay Sera plans to bring deep emotion with her perfect control of tempo and delicate expressiveness. In particular, expectations are high that the explosive high notes that are her trademark will increase the immersion.
Jay Sera, who debuted in 2010 with her first single ‘Lonely Night’, has been loved for a long time by releasing many hit songs such as ‘I Came Alone’, ‘You Really Don‘t Know’, ‘Love Poem Confession Gu Haengbok-dong’, ‘I Always Love You’. In particular, she recently released the 2025 version of ‘I Came Alone’ and garnered a lot of attention.
